    Intelligent Buffer Management Algorithm to Prevent Packet loss in Mobile Adhoc Network

    In a mobile ad hoc network, which is self-organized and operates without any fundamental infrastructure, packet transmission from the source node to the destination node is completed after sending the route request and route reply. A reliable path is then selected depending on the protocol choice.  Data that the sender intends to deliver is broken up into packets and given sequence numbers before being transmitted over the channel. With the aid of an internal buffer that helps to receive packets and forward them to the next destination, each and every packet travels along the allotted path until it reaches its destination. If there is more traffic on the MANET, the buffer may overflow, which will result in packet loss during transmission..  The source node must retransmit to the destination if any packets were lost during the initial transfer. This article proposes the Intelligent  Buffer Management (IBM) active buffer management algorithm to prevent such a scenario by enhancing the MANET nodes' buffers to prevent packet loss. The Network Simulator is used to help build this suggested approach, and the results are compared to those of the current buffer management method to show that IBM is superior
